The Allure of Provably Fair Gaming and Its Impact
One of the standout innovations in bitcoin casino sites is the concept of provably fair gaming. This system allows players to verify the fairness of each game outcome independently, a feature that’s scarce in conventional online gambling. The technology relies on cryptographic hashing to ensure that neither the casino nor the player can manipulate results.
Games like net slots or blackjack variants from providers such as NetEnt often incorporate these mechanisms. Although the RTP (return to player) rates hover around the familiar 96-97% range, the trust factor adds a new dimension to the player’s confidence. It’s not just about winning but knowing that the game isn’t rigged behind the scenes.
Practical Tips for Navigating Bitcoin Casino Sites
While the idea of playing with Bitcoin is thrilling, approaching these platforms without preparation can lead to common pitfalls. Here are some practical suggestions to keep in mind:
- Verify licensing and regulatory compliance, even though crypto casinos often operate under less traditional jurisdictions.
- Understand wallet compatibility—make sure your Bitcoin wallet supports quick and secure deposits and withdrawals.
- Check game variety and software providers to find titles that match your preferences.
- Be aware of the volatility of cryptocurrency values to manage your bankroll effectively.
- Investigate bonus terms cautiously, as some promotions might have different wagering requirements in crypto environments.

Understanding Payment Methods and Security Measures
Bitcoin casino platforms depend heavily on robust security protocols to protect users’ funds and data. SSL encryption is standard, ensuring that transactions and personal information remain confidential. But beyond technical safeguards, the decentralized nature of Bitcoin itself provides an extra security layer against fraud and identity theft.
Many casinos also support alternative cryptocurrencies and payment options like Lightning Network payments, which speed up transactions and reduce fees. This flexibility is a major reason why more players are drawn to these platforms.
